To hack Final Fantasy XIII-2, I know there is a program that changes stats and all that. Do I need to hack the xbox or can it be done without hacking?
 
I'm most positive you're talking about a save editor which needs no modded xbox. Just a thumbdrive to extract the game save, and use the editor, then reimport it to the 360.
 
I'm most positive you're talking about a save editor which needs no modded xbox. Just a thumbdrive to extract the game save, and use the editor, then reimport it to the 360.

Exactly that.

Horizon and Modio are 2 tools which can do that job.
But beware.
This is cheating and you CAN GET BANNED FOR IT.

Achievements and save editing are a somewhat different matter.

As for catching you MS have been hard on cheating for many years now (the console revocation list actually being in practice way before even DVD hacking really took off in a big way). Depending upon how you sign your save you could get seen, depending upon your edits you could get seen and it need not even be silly although that would just be making their life easier, just something impossible in the general game and frankly if you are going to put the time in to work that out just grind like every other poor bastard that plays such a game.

If you have an offline console cheat away. If you must do it on a console that someone cares about Live for do it offline, do it for an offline profile that you will delete as soon as you get bored and do not cheat hard and even then when the banhammer swings your way "I told you so and here is how to get files off the drive and set up a new box" is about the best you can hope for from those around here or indeed anywhere.
